OBJECTIVES: The primary objective of the present study was to examine the role of sex as a moderator of the relation between depression and activity-related pain.METHODS: The study sample consisted of 83 participants (42 women, 41 men) with musculoskeletal conditions. Participants were asked to lift a series of 18 canisters that varied in weight (2.9 kg, 3.4 kg and 3.9 kg) and distance from the body. Participants were asked to rate their pain while they lifted each canister and estimate the weight of the canisters.RESULTS: Consistent with previous research, the relations among depression, pain intensity and disability were stronger for women than for men. ANOVA revealed that depression was associated with more intense activity-related pain in women only. For both women and men, the intensity of pain increased with each trial, although the weight of the objects lifted remained constant. Neither sex nor depression had an effect on participants’ weight estimates.CONCLUSIONS: The present discussion addresses the mechanisms through which depression may differentially affect pain in women and men. It also addresses the potential clinical implications of pain-augmenting effects of depression in women.

The role of evolutionary biology as a basic science for medicine is expanding rapidly. Some evolutionary methods are already widely applied in medicine, such as population genetics and methods for analysing phylogenetic trees. Newer applications come from seeking evolutionary as well as proximate explanations for disease. Traditional medical research is restricted to proximate studies of the body’s mechanism, but separate evolutionary explanations are needed for why natural selection has left many aspects of the body vulnerable to disease. There are six main possibilities: mismatch, infection, constraints, trade-offs, reproduction at the cost of health, and adaptive defences. Like other basic sciences, evolutionary biology has limited direct clinical implications, but it provides essential research methods, encourages asking new questions that foster a deeper understanding of disease, and provides a framework that organizes the facts of medicine.

The 2013 House of Delegates of the American Physical Therapy Association adopted a vision statement that addresses the role of physical therapy in transforming society through optimizing movement. The accompanying guidelines address the movement system as key to achieving this vision. The profession has incorporated movement in position statements and documents since the early 1980s, but movement as a physiological system has not been addressed. Clearly, those health care professions identified with a system of the body are more easily recognized for their expertise and role in preventing, diagnosing, and treating dysfunctions of the system than health professions identified with intervention but not a system. This perspective article provides a brief history of how leaders in the profession have advocated for clear identification of a body of knowledge. The reasons are discussed for why movement can be considered a physiological system, as are the advantages of promoting the system rather than just movement. In many ways, a focus on movement is more restrictive than incorporating the concept of the movement system. Promotion of the movement system also provides a logical context for the diagnoses made by physical therapists. In addition, there is growing evidence, particularly in relation to musculoskeletal conditions, that the focus is enlarging from pathoanatomy to pathokinesiology, further emphasizing the timeliness of promoting the role of movement as a system. Discussion also addresses musculoskeletal conditions as lifestyle issues in the same way that general health has been demonstrated to be clearly related to lifestyle. The suggestion is made that the profession should be addressing kinesiopathologic conditions and not just pathokinesiologic conditions, as would be in keeping with the physical therapist's role in prevention and as a life-span practitioner.

Objectives: According to traditional views, perfectionists are prone to experience shame and guilt. As a relative part of negative body image, body appreciation reflects an appreciation attitude toward physical characteristics, functionality, and health, accepting and appreciating all parts and functions of the body, predicting body-related shame and guilt.Methods: Therefore, body appreciation was examined for its potential mediating role in the relationship between two dimensions of perfectionism (e.g., healthy perfectionism and unhealthy perfectionism) and body-related shame and body-related guilt among 514 females.Results: The results highlight that body appreciation partially mediated the relationship between perfectionism and body-related shame and body-related guilt. Implications for enhancing body appreciation among females between experiencing healthy or unhealthy perfectionism and body-related shame and body-related guilt feelings are discussed.Conclusions: These findings underscore the importance of considering body appreciation in addressing perfectionism dimensions and body-related shame and body-related guilt. Research and clinical implications are also addressed.

OBJECTIVE: First and second violinists in orchestras use identical instruments, but the motor patterns used to execute the different notes may vary between the two groups and the biomechanical gestures may influence musculoskeletal complaints. The primary objective of this study was to compare the pain intensity and interference in musical performance of first and second violinists of professional youth chamber orchestras. Second, to investigate the correlation between pain and the musical practice profile in this population. METHODS: This cross-sectional study enrolled 74 violinists, aged 12 to 17 years, from three professional youth chamber orchestras in Brazil. Participants completed a validated self-administered questionnaire, the Musculoskeletal Pain Intensity and Interference Questionnaire for Musicians–Brazilian version (MPIIQM-Br). Variables related to musical practice profiles were also recorded. Data analysis applied t-tests for independent samples and Pearson’s correlation coefficient. RESULTS: The sample of first violinists (n=39) presented 23 males and 16 females, and the second violinists (n=35) included 23 females and 12 males. The mean age was 13.9 yrs (SD 1.1) and 14.1 yrs (1.0) for the first and second violinist groups, respectively. Most participants (n=66, 89%) reported pain in at least one moment of their career, and 54 (76%) reported pain at the time of data collection. A higher pain prevalence was identified in the right shoulder (37.7%), in 28.2% of the second violinists and 9.4% of the first. The second violinists presented higher scores for most variables related to pain intensity and pain interference in performance (p < 0.05). A correlation was observed between time working at a professional level and the number of affected areas on the body pain map (r=0.30; 95% CI 0.23–0.42) and between the hours of daily practice and the number of affected areas on the body pain map (r=0.39; 95% CI 0.29–0.45). CONCLUSION: Second violinists had more complaints of pain and difficulty in playing their instrument compared to the first violinists. The study also found a correlation between the number of body areas with pain complaints and variables linked to the violinists’ practice profile.

While large numbers of women report high levels of psychological distress associated with endometriosis, others report levels of distress that are comparable to those of healthy women. Thus, the aim of the current study was to develop an explanatory model for the effect of endometriosis on women’s psychological distress. Furthermore, it sought to further investigate the role of body image, self-criticism, and pain intensity on the psychological distress associated with endometriosis and establish the effect of chronic illness load on the development of this distress. This study comprised a total of 247 women aged 20–49 (M = 31.3, SD = 6.4)—73 suffering from endometriosis only, 62 suffering from endometriosis and an additional chronical illness (ACI), and 112 healthy peers (HP)—who completed the Patient Health Questionnaire, the Generalized Anxiety Disorder-Item Scale, the Body Appreciation Scale-2, and the Self-Criticism Sub-Scale. When comparing each endometriosis group to their HP’s, we found that the differences between HP and endometriosis ACI in depression and anxiety were mediated by body image (Betas = 0.17 and 0.09, respectively, p’s < 0.05) and self-criticism (Betas = 0.23 and 0.26, respectively, p’s < 0.05). When comparing endometriosis participants to endometriosis ACI participants, differences in depression were mediated by body image, self-criticism, and pain intensity (Betas = 0.12, 0.13, 0.13 respectively, p’s < 0.05), and the differences in anxiety were mediated by self-criticism and pain intensity (Betas = 0.19, 0.08, respectively, p’s < 0.05). Physicians and other health professionals are advised to detect women with endometriosis ACI who are distressed, and to offer them appropriate intervention.

Objective The aim of the present study was to evaluate the role of the Advanced Musculoskeletal Physiotherapist (AMP) in managing patients brought in by ambulance to the emergency department (ED). Methods This study was a dual-centre observational study. Patients brought in by ambulance to two Melbourne hospitals over a 12-month period and seen by an AMP were compared with a matched group seen by other ED staff. Primary outcome measures were wait time and length of stay (LOS) in the ED. Results Data from 1441 patients within the Australasian Triage Scale (ATS) Categories 3–5 with musculoskeletal complaints were included in the analysis. Subgroup analysis of 825 patients aged ≤65 years demonstrated that for Category 4 (semi-urgent) patients, the median wait time to see the AMP was 9.5 min (interquartile range (IQR) 3.25–18.00 min) compared with 25 min (IQR 10.00–56.00 min) to see other ED staff (P ≤ 0.05). LOS analysis was undertaken on patients discharged home and demonstrated that there was a 1.20 greater probability (95% confidence interval 1.07–1.35) that ATS Category 4 patients managed by the AMP were discharged within the 4-hour public hospital target compared with patients managed by other ED staff: 87.04% (94/108) of patients managed by the AMPs met this standard compared with 72.35% (123/170) of patients managed by other ED staff (P = 0.002). Conclusions Patients aged ≤65 years with musculoskeletal complaints brought in by ambulance to the ED and triaged to ATS Category 4 are likely to wait less time to be seen and are discharged home more quickly when managed by an AMP. This study has added to the evidence that AMPs improve patient flow in the ED, freeing up time for other ED staff to see higher-acuity, more complex patients. What is known about the topic? There is a growing body of evidence establishing that AMPs improve the flow of patients presenting with musculoskeletal conditions to the ED through reduced wait times and LOS and, at the same time, providing good-quality care and enhanced patient satisfaction. What does this paper add? Within their primary contact capacity, AMPs also manage patients who are brought in by ambulance presenting with musculoskeletal conditions. To the authors’ knowledge, there is currently no available literature documenting the performance of AMPs in the management of this cohort of patients. What are the implications for practitioners? This study has added to the body of evidence that AMPs improve patient flow in the ED and illustrates that AMPs, by seeing patients brought in by ambulance, are able to have a positive impact on the pressures increasingly facing the Victorian Ambulance Service and emergency hospital care.

Dietary polyphenols have been shown to scavenge free radicals, modulating cellular redox transcription factors in different in vitro and ex vivo models. Dietary intervention studies have shown that consumption of plant foods modulates plasma Non-Enzymatic Antioxidant Capacity (NEAC), a biomarker of the endogenous antioxidant network, in human subjects. However, the identification of the molecules responsible for this effect are yet to be obtained and evidences of an antioxidant in vivo action of polyphenols are conflicting. There is a clear discrepancy between polyphenols (PP) concentration in body fluids and the extent of increase of plasma NEAC. The low degree of absorption and the extensive metabolism of PP within the body have raised questions about their contribution to the endogenous antioxidant network. This work will discuss the role of polyphenols from galenic preparation, food extracts, and selected dietary sources as modulators of plasma NEAC in humans.

AbstractThis paper introduces some levels at which the computer has been incorporated in the research into the basis of electrocardiography. The emphasis lies on the modeling of the heart as an electrical current generator and of the properties of the body as a volume conductor, both playing a major role in the shaping of the electrocardiographic waveforms recorded at the body surface. It is claimed that the Forward-Problem of electrocardiography is no longer a problem. Several source models of cardiac electrical activity are considered, one of which can be directly interpreted in terms of the underlying electrophysiology (the depolarization sequence of the ventricles). The importance of using tailored rather than textbook geometry in inverse procedures is stressed.

SummaryBlood was injected into the brains of dogs to produce artificial haematomas, and paraffin injected to produce intracerebral paraffin masses. Cerebrospinal fluid (CSF) and peripheral blood samples were withdrawn at regular intervals and their fibrinolytic activities estimated by the fibrin plate method. Trans-form aminomethylcyclohexane-carboxylic acid (t-AMCHA) was administered to some individuals. Genera] relationships were found between changes in CSF fibrinolytic activity, area of tissue damage and survival time. t-AMCHA was clearly beneficial to those animals given a programme of administration. Tissue activator was extracted from the brain tissue after death or sacrifice for haematoma examination. The possible role of tissue activator in relation to haematoma development, and clinical implications of the results, are discussed.
